Abstract

The text proceeds a reinterpretation of the mainstream thinking on environmetnal policies, trying to interrogate it about the absence of reflexion on environmental negationism. The governamental strategy of dismanteling environemental regulatory agencies that began to be developed in Brazil in 2019 is discussed from the point of view of the history of environmental Brazilian debate, serving as well to point some gaps in the literature responsible for introducing environmental policies in the field of applied social sciences.
